Even those who have gone through all generations praise the sound

Inside are 13mm drivers with aptX and Hi-Res audio support, Bluetooth is version 5.4, and IPX5 certification handles sweat and rain. The most interesting feature, however, is in-app ear sound characteristic measurement – the headphones adapt the sound directly to your hearing. One loyal owner, who has gone through all generations of the Air series, summarized it clearly: “for less than half the price, it offers better sound than AirPods” and adds that “noise cancellation surprisingly works” – which is certainly not a given for open-fit earbuds.

Why they only have 3.8 stars

The rating of 3.8 out of 5 from 28 customers requires an explanation, as reviews are split into two camps. Satisfied customers praise the sound, app, and design; dissatisfied ones point out three specific issues. Firstly, the fit – “doesn’t sit in the ears” is the most concise review on the list, and with open-fit earbuds, it’s simply a lottery of ear shape. Secondly, the app requires registration, which caused one buyer to return the headphones immediately. And thirdly, minor details: voice announcements have an unpleasant echo (“reverberation like from a bare prison cell,” one reviewer aptly wrote) and the glossy case is a scratch magnet. None of this spoils the sound – but it’s fair to know beforehand. At 839 CZK, it’s a gamble with an excellent win/risk ratio; at the original two thousand, we would hesitate.
